What it is, How it works

Hair testing is widely acknowledged as a formidable method for identifying drug and alcohol consumption. By ensnaring biomarkers in the fibers of the growing hair, hair offers an extended timeline of alcohol and drug usage. When taken from the scalp, hair delivers up to nearly a 3-month detection range for both alcohol and drugs. The collection process of hair is straightforward, challenging to tamper with, and simple to transport.

A 1.5-inch section comprising roughly 200 hair strands (approximately the width of a #2 pencil) nearest to the scalp yields 100mg of hair, which is optimal for analysis and verification. For EtG, supplementary tests, and/or panels exceeding 10, it is advisable to gather 150mg of the sample. Utilizing a jeweler’s scale is suggested for weighing the specimen. Should scalp hair be inaccessible, an equivalent volume of body hair may be sourced. In reference to head hair, only scalp hair is implied. Body hair encompasses all other varieties (facial, axillary, etc.).

Process Overview

The laboratory processing of a drug test follows four primary phases: Accessioning, Screening, Extraction, and Confirmation.

Accessioning pertains to the primary handling of a sample within a lab's system. This step involves checking that the sample was properly sealed and delivered, attributing a random LAN (Laboratory Accessioning Number), and finishing any additional data input not covered by an electronic chain of custody arrangement.

Screening is an initial rapid analysis for drugs of abuse. While Screening provides an economical means to exclude drug presence in most samples, any positive screen requires validation to be acceptable in legal settings. Any samples found initially positive in Screening necessitate a further confirmation.

If a sample shows an initial positive result in Screening, extra hair is extracted from the original sample for the Extraction process. At this phase, drugs are drawn out from the hair at a considerably lower concentration than other methods (e.g., urine or oral fluid), which accounts for the complexity of hair drug screening.

To affirm any positive screening result, GC/MS, GC/MS/MS or LC/MS/MS technologies are utilized. All initially positive samples undergo washing prior to confirmation when necessary. The entire laboratory method from Accessioning to Confirmation undergoes scrutiny under both the CAP (College of American Pathologists) Hair standards and the accreditation to ISO / IEC 17025 stipulations.

Advantages of hair drug testing:

  • Prolonged detection period: Hair drug tests identify drug consumption for as long as 90 days, in contrast to the briefer detection period of urine tests.
  • Hard to manipulate: Cheating a hair drug test is significantly challenging, enhancing the precision of the results.
  • Reflects historical consumption: It reveals a trend of drug use over time, not just recent consumption.

Limitations:

  • Inability to detect recent usage: Drugs become noticeable in hair only after about 5-7 days.
  • Expense: Hair drug tests generally incur higher costs compared to other testing methods.
  • Outcome variability: Elements like hair color and personal differences in hair growth can influence drug metabolite concentration in hair.

Note: Though often termed as "hair follicle tests", the examination inspects the hair strand rather than the hair follicle beneath the scalp

What's New In Hair Follicle Drug Testing according to the Hair Drug Testing Experts

With its multidisciplinary nature, hair testing brings together researchers, scientists, and experts from various domains to develop innovative techniques, explore new methodologies, and address emerging concerns, responding to the ever-evolving challenges of drug abuse, therapeutic drug monitoring, and environmental exposures to pollutants.

The joint meeting of the Society of Hair Testing (SoHT) and the Italian Group of Forensic Toxicologists (GTFI) was organized in Verona, June 8–10, 2022, and hosted by the Legal Medicine team of the Verona University Hospital, directed by Franco Tagliaro together with Federica Bortolotti and Rossella Gottardo.

It served as a prominent platform for knowledge exchange and collaboration, facilitating groundbreaking advancements in hair testing and analysis. In this special issue of Drug Testing and Analysis, we aim to showcase the remarkable manuscripts presented at this significant event, shedding light on the latest research and highlighting the future directions in this field.

Novel Analytical Techniques: The Verona meeting witnessed the unveiling of cutting-edge analytical techniques, offering enhanced sensitivity, selectivity, and accuracy for drug testing. Remarkable advancements in sample preparation, detection, and identification of drug compounds have been presented. The manuscripts in this section presented novel approaches, such as multianalyte methods and on-line preparation which can enable rapid analysis and improve thorough forensic investigations.

Biomarkers and Pharmacokinetics: The identification and validation of reliable biomarkers and pharmacokinetic studies are fundamental aspects of drug testing and analysis. The impact of hair treatments on the oxidation/decomposition of drugs in hair was also explored, as the long-term fate of drugs incorporated in the keratin matrix. Furthermore, the SoHT meeting in Verona featured research on the identification and quantification of alcohol abuse biomarkers, their stability, and their correlation with exposure and other biomarkers.

Forensic Applications and Interpretation: One of the vital objectives of hair testing is its application in forensic investigations and legal proceedings. The SoHT meeting in Verona emphasized the significance of rigorous interpretation of analytical results and the need for standardized protocols. Manuscripts in this section present advancements in forensic toxicology, and have explored the challenges posed by emerging designer drugs and strategies to combat their proliferation. The pitfalls encountered when the exogenous/endogenous nature of a substance is questioned were presented and discussed. The special issue presents also manuscripts that delve into the ethical implications of drug testing in drug facilitated sexual assaults.

Clinical Applications of hair testing are witnessed by the insight on environmental tobacco smoke exposure, assessed by hair analysis in a population of students and the study of in utero-exposure to drugs of abuse through neonatal hair analysis. Exposure to drugs was also important in cases of child abuse/neglect, when the clinical purpose of hair testing merge with its forensic applications.

The legal framework surrounding hair testing and the achievement of guidelines to ensure fairness, accuracy, and confidentiality in drug testing practices have also been discussed,and the SoHT consensus on general hair testing and testing for drugs of abuse was presented at the meeting and published as a Letter to the Editor.

A hair follicle drug test analyzes a small sample of hair to detect a history of drug use over time. Because drug metabolites are incorporated into hair as it grows, this method can show patterns of use instead of just recent exposure. It is frequently used for legal and court requirements, long-term monitoring, and high-trust workforce screening.
Standard hair drug testing typically reflects drug use over approximately a 90-day period, based on the length of hair collected at the time of testing. Longer hair can sometimes reflect a longer time frame, and extremely short hair can reduce that window.
Hair drug testing commonly screens for marijuana/THC, cocaine, opiates/opioids, amphetamines/methamphetamines, and PCP. In many cases, additional expanded panels may be requested to include other substances.
Yes. If the donor's head hair is too short or unavailable, body hair may be collected as an alternative. The collector will document the source of the sample. This allows testing even for individuals with recently cut or shaved head hair.
